Numerical Simulation Study of Thermal Recovery by Horizontal Wells in Caogu 1 Block -- A Fractured Limestone Heavy Oil Reservoir

摘要

Caogu 1 block of Le'an oil field is a typical fractured limestone heavy oil reservoir. Reservoir depth is from 660-900m. The reservoir lithology mainly consist of gray cryptocrystalline limestone and dolomite. The major reservoir pore space has fractures and solution void. However, the matrix of limestone does not contain any oil, and the permeability of fracture is large. After the geological properties of Caogu 1 block has been fully studied, the geological model and numerical model of thermal recovery are established. This is suitable for fractured limestone heavy oil reservoir characterization.
